I recenlty let creative cloud upgrad lightroom to release 12.5. Since then, clicking the masking tool freezes the system for about 90 seconds. I think it's trying to detect faces, but I'm not sure. Is there a way to turn the facial detection off?
I'm on Windows with an Intel(R) Core(TM) i7-8700K CPU @ 3.70GHz processor, 32 GB of RAM and an Nvidia GTX 1070 Ti video care

In Grid Mode in Library Pause Face Detection by clicking on the identity plate in the upper-left corner and then clicking the pause button

Turning off 'People' detection in Masks isn't possible. However, you can toggle the exposure triangle to close the 'People' section of thae masks panel. Since the exposure triangle status is sticky you should find that it will be closed by deafult with subsequent images. You should also find that opening the masking panel is faster and less likely to cause freezes when the 'People' panel is closed.
Note that the usual reason for the issue you describle is insufficient dedicated GPU VRAM (minimum is 2GB) or outdated GPU drivers. The latest driver for your card should be available at below link.
